import type { InferCreationAttributes } from "sequelize";
import { Op } from "sequelize";
import type { UserRole } from "@shared/types";
import InviteAcceptedEmail from "@server/emails/templates/InviteAcceptedEmail";
import {
DomainNotAllowedError,
InvalidAuthenticationError,
InviteRequiredError,
} from "@server/errors";
import Logger from "@server/logging/Logger";
import { Team, User, UserAuthentication } from "@server/models";
import { sequelize } from "@server/storage/database";
import type { APIContext } from "@server/types";
import { UserFlag } from "@server/models/User";
import UploadUserAvatarTask from "@server/queues/tasks/UploadUserAvatarTask";
type UserProvisionerResult = {
user: User;
isNewUser: boolean;
authentication: UserAuthentication | null;
};
type Props = {
/** The displayed name of the user */
name: string;
/** The email address of the user */
email: string;
/**
* Whether the provider has verified the user owns the email address.
* Matching an existing account by email only happens when explicitly true.
*/
emailVerified?: boolean;
/** The display name of the authentication provider, eg "Google". */
authenticationProviderName?: string;
/** The language of the user, if known */
language?: string;
/** The role for new user, Member if none is provided */
role?: UserRole;
/** The public url of an image representing the user */
avatarUrl?: string | null;
/**
* The internal ID of the team that is being logged into based on the
* subdomain that the request came from, if any.
*/
teamId: string;
/** Bundle of props related to the current external provider authentication */
authentication?: {
authenticationProviderId: string;
/** External identifier of the user in the authentication provider */
providerId: string | number;
/** The scopes granted by the access token */
scopes: string[];
/** The token provided by the authentication provider */
accessToken?: string;
/** The refresh token provided by the authentication provider */
refreshToken?: string;
/** The timestamp when the access token expires */
expiresAt?: Date;
};
};
export default async function userProvisioner(
ctx: APIContext,
{
name,
email,
emailVerified,
authenticationProviderName,
role,
language,
avatarUrl,
teamId,
authentication,
}: Props
): Promise<UserProvisionerResult> {
const auth = authentication
? await UserAuthentication.findOne({
where: {
providerId: String(authentication.providerId),
},
include: [
{
model: User,
as: "user",
where: { teamId },
required: true,
},
],
})
: undefined;
// Someone has signed in with this authentication before, we just
// want to update the details instead of creating a new record
if (auth && authentication) {
const { providerId, authenticationProviderId, ...rest } = authentication;
const { user } = auth;
// We found an authentication record that matches the user id, but it's
// associated with a different authentication provider, (eg a different
// hosted google domain or Discord server). This can happen when moving
// domains or changing server configurations. Auto-migrate to the new provider.
if (auth.authenticationProviderId !== authenticationProviderId) {
Logger.info(
"authentication",
"Migrating user to new authentication provider",
{
userId: user?.id,
providerId,
fromAuthenticationProviderId: auth.authenticationProviderId,
toAuthenticationProviderId: authenticationProviderId,
}
);
await auth.update({ authenticationProviderId });
}
if (user) {
if (avatarUrl && !user.getFlag(UserFlag.AvatarUpdated)) {
await new UploadUserAvatarTask().schedule({
userId: user.id,
avatarUrl,
});
}
await user.update({ email });
await auth.update(rest);
return {
user,
authentication: auth,
isNewUser: false,
};
}
// We found an authentication record, but the associated user was deleted or
// otherwise didn't exist. Cleanup the auth record and proceed with creating
// a new user. See: https://github.com/outline/outline/issues/2022
await auth.destroy();
}
// A `user` record may exist even if there is no existing authentication record.
// This is either an invite or a user that's external to the team
const existingUser = await User.scope(["withTeam"]).findOne({
where: {
// Email from auth providers may be capitalized
email: {
[Op.iLike]: email,
},
teamId,
},
});
const team = await Team.scope("withDomains").findByPk(teamId, {
attributes: ["defaultUserRole", "inviteRequired", "id"],
});
// Unverified emails cannot match an existing account or pass allow listed domains
if (emailVerified !== true && (existingUser || team?.allowedDomains.length)) {
const providerName = authenticationProviderName ?? "your identity provider";
throw InvalidAuthenticationError(
`Your email address has not been verified by ${providerName}. Please verify your email and try signing in again.`
);
}
// We have an existing user, so we need to update it with our
// new details and count this as a new user creation.
if (existingUser) {
// A `user` record might exist in the form of an invite.
// An invite is a shell user record with no authentication method
// that's never been active before.
const isInvite = existingUser.isInvited;
const userAuth = await sequelize.transaction(async (transaction) => {
// Regardless, create a new authentication record
// against the existing user (user can auth with multiple SSO providers)
// Update user's name and avatar based on the most recently added provider
await existingUser.update(
{
name,
avatarUrl,
lastActiveAt: new Date(),
lastActiveIp: ctx.ip,
},
{
transaction,
}
);
// Only need to associate the authentication with the user if there is one.
if (!authentication) {
return null;
}
return await existingUser.$create<UserAuthentication>(
"authentication",
authentication,
{
transaction,
}
);
});
if (avatarUrl && !existingUser.getFlag(UserFlag.AvatarUpdated)) {
await new UploadUserAvatarTask().schedule({
userId: existingUser.id,
avatarUrl,
});
}
if (isInvite) {
const inviter = await existingUser.$get("invitedBy");
if (inviter) {
await new InviteAcceptedEmail({
to: inviter.email,
language: inviter.language,
inviterId: inviter.id,
invitedName: existingUser.name,
teamUrl: existingUser.team.url,
}).schedule();
}
}
return {
user: existingUser,
authentication: userAuth,
isNewUser: isInvite,
};
} else if (!authentication && !team?.allowedDomains.length) {
// There's no existing invite or user that matches the external auth email
// and there is no possibility of matching an allowed domain.
throw InvalidAuthenticationError(
"No matching user for email or allowed domain"
);
}
//
// No auth, no user this is an entirely new sign in.
//
const transaction = await User.sequelize!.transaction();
try {
// If the team settings are set to require invites, and there's no existing user record,
// throw an error and fail user creation.
if (team?.inviteRequired) {
Logger.info("authentication", "Sign in without invitation", {
teamId: team.id,
email,
});
throw InviteRequiredError();
}
// If the team settings do not allow this domain,
// throw an error and fail user creation.
if (team && !(await team.isDomainAllowed(email))) {
throw DomainNotAllowedError();
}
const user = await User.createWithCtx(
ctx,
{
name,
email,
language,
role: role ?? team?.defaultUserRole,
teamId,
avatarUrl,
authentications: authentication ? [authentication] : [],
lastActiveAt: new Date(),
lastActiveIp: ctx.ip,
} as Partial<InferCreationAttributes<User>>,
undefined,
{
include: "authentications",
}
);
await transaction.commit();
return {
user,
authentication: user.authentications[0],
isNewUser: true,
};
} catch (err) {
await transaction.rollback();
throw err;
}
}
